Thin lens(urgent)
1.A plano-convex lens having a focal length of 250mm is to be made of glass of refractive index n =1.520. Calculate the radius of curvature of the grinding and polishing tools that must be used to make this lens.
(1/f) = (n – 1)(1/R)
1 / 250 = (1.520 – 1)(1/R)
R = (1.520 – 1) x 250
R = 130mm
2.The radii of both surfaces of an equiconvex lens of index 1.60 are equal to 80mm. Find its power.
(1/f) = (n – 1)[(1/R1) + (1/R2)]
(1/f) = (1.6 – 1)[(1/80) + (1/80)]
f = 66.7mm = 0.0667m
power = 1/f = 1 / 0.0667
= 15D
